Electric Motorcycle Market Growth: Current State and Market Size
The electric motorcycle market is experiencing rapid growth. Industry leaders are reporting impressive sales figures as consumer interest surges. A recent market analysis reveals a significant increase in global market share for electric two-wheelers.
Zero Motorcycles, a pioneer in the field, has seen its sales double in the past year. Energica, an Italian manufacturer, reports a 91% increase in revenue. Even traditional brands like Harley-Davidson are entering the market with their LiveWire division, capturing a new demographic.
“The electric motorcycle industry is at a tipping point. We’re seeing unprecedented growth and adoption rates,” says the CEO of a leading electric motorcycle company.
Regional trends show varying adoption rates. Europe leads in market size, followed closely by Asia-Pacific. North America is catching up quickly, with sales figures showing strong year-over-year growth.
| Region | Market Share (%) | Annual Growth Rate (%) |
|---|---|---|
| Europe | 35 | 22 |
| Asia-Pacific | 30 | 25 |
| North America | 25 | 18 |
| Rest of World | 10 | 15 |
The global electric motorcycle market size is projected to reach $12.5 billion by 2025, with a compound annual growth rate of 7.3%. This rapid expansion is driven by technological advancements, environmental concerns, and supportive government policies.
Technological Advancements Driving the Industry
Electric motorcycle technology is evolving at a rapid pace. Battery technology stands at the forefront of this revolution. New lithium-ion batteries boast higher energy densities, enabling significant range improvements. Some models now offer up to 250 miles on a single charge, rivaling their gas-powered counterparts.
Charging infrastructure is expanding quickly. Fast-charging stations are popping up across cities and highways, reducing range anxiety. Many e-motorcycles can now reach 80% charge in under 30 minutes, making long-distance rides more feasible.
Performance enhancements are reshaping the industry. Electric motors deliver instant torque, resulting in quicker acceleration than traditional bikes. Advanced motor designs and power management systems are pushing top speeds beyond 150 mph, challenging perceptions about electric vehicle capabilities.
| Advancement | Impact |
|---|---|
| Improved Battery Technology | 250+ mile range |
| Fast-Charging Infrastructure | 80% charge in 30 minutes |
| Enhanced Motor Efficiency | Top speeds over 150 mph |
| Smart Features Integration | GPS, smartphone connectivity |
Smart features are becoming standard in e-motorcycles. GPS navigation, smartphone connectivity, and digital dashboards enhance the riding experience. These technologies not only improve safety but also allow riders to stay connected on the go.

Environmental Impact and Sustainability Benefits
Electric motorcycles are revolutionizing eco-friendly transportation. These vehicles significantly reduce carbon emissions compared to their gas-powered counterparts. A lifecycle analysis of electric motorcycles shows they produce up to 70% fewer emissions over their lifespan.

Sustainable manufacturing practices are gaining traction in the e-motorcycle industry. Companies are using recycled materials and implementing energy-efficient production methods. This shift not only reduces environmental impact but also lowers production costs.
The benefits of electric motorcycles extend beyond carbon emissions reduction. They contribute to cleaner air in urban areas and significantly reduce noise pollution. This makes them ideal for dense city environments where air quality and noise are major concerns.
“Electric motorcycles are not just a trend, they’re a sustainable solution for urban mobility.”
Let’s compare the environmental impact of electric and gasoline motorcycles:
| Factor | Electric Motorcycle | Gasoline Motorcycle |
|---|---|---|
| CO2 Emissions (g/km) | 22 | 103 |
| Noise Level (dB) | 65 | 90 |
| Fuel Efficiency (km/L equivalent) | 100 | 25 |
| Maintenance Waste | Minimal | Significant |
As the industry grows, the focus on sustainability will likely intensify. Innovations in battery technology and recycling processes will further enhance the eco-friendliness of electric motorcycles, cementing their role in sustainable urban transportation.
Regulatory Framework and Government Incentives
Governments worldwide are implementing electric vehicle policies to promote e-motorcycle adoption. These policies aim to reduce carbon emissions and improve urban air quality. Many countries offer tax credits to make electric motorcycles more affordable for consumers.
Emission standards play a crucial role in shaping the e-motorcycle market. Stricter regulations on traditional gas-powered vehicles push manufacturers to develop cleaner alternatives. This shift benefits electric motorcycles, which produce zero tailpipe emissions.
Urban mobility regulations are evolving to favor electric two-wheelers. Some cities have introduced low-emission zones, where only electric vehicles are allowed. This trend encourages commuters to switch to e-motorcycles for daily transportation.
“Electric motorcycles are becoming an integral part of sustainable urban transportation plans.”
Let’s look at some government incentives for electric motorcycles across different countries:
| Country | Incentive Type | Value |
|---|---|---|
| United States | Federal Tax Credit | Up to $2,500 |
| France | Purchase Subsidy | Up to €900 |
| China | Registration Fee Waiver | 100% waived |
| India | GST Reduction | 5% (down from 12%) |
These incentives, combined with improving technology and growing environmental awareness, are driving the rapid expansion of the electric motorcycle market globally.
Market Challenges and Barriers
The electric motorcycle market faces several hurdles on its path to widespread adoption. Range anxiety remains a top concern for potential buyers. Many riders worry about running out of power during long trips, limiting their willingness to switch from gas-powered bikes.
Charging infrastructure is another major obstacle. Unlike gas stations, charging points for electric motorcycles are not yet ubiquitous. This lack of convenient charging options further fuels range anxiety and hinders market growth.

Consumer perception plays a crucial role in market expansion. Some riders still view electric motorcycles as less powerful or less “authentic” than their traditional counterparts. Changing these perceptions requires time and effective marketing strategies.
Market competition is intensifying as traditional motorcycle manufacturers enter the electric segment. This table highlights key players and their strategies:
| Manufacturer | Strategy | Key Electric Models |
|---|---|---|
| Harley-Davidson | Dedicated electric sub-brand | LiveWire One |
| Zero Motorcycles | Focus on high-performance electric bikes | SR/F, SR/S |
| BMW | Integration of electric models into existing lineup | CE 04 |
| Energica | Emphasis on racing technology | Ego, Eva Ribelle |
Overcoming these challenges will be crucial for the electric motorcycle industry to reach its full potential and transform the two-wheeled transportation landscape.
